Transaction 70bf898cfd3964725e3dbf33ec3023c54d22f642f848d3107a7a639fa5a18638
1 Input
1 Output
-
70bf898cfd3964725e3dbf33ec3023c54d22f642f848d3107a7a639fa5a18638:0
- value
- 853485
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 186045efe7e490b79186b4443b477a377917f948 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13DtYnPaap4zaN6nAKNikx5BQbU84jrRgK